Persistent expression of clonotypic IgM is significantly correlated with decreased survival. / Kaplan-Meier survival curves comparing patients with detectable clonotypic IgM transcripts in less than 50% of blood samples (low IgM detection rate, or IgM-DR) versus patients with clonotypic IgM transcripts in 50% or more of blood samples (high IgM-DR). The group with low IgM-DR exhibits significantly better survival than the group with high IgM-DR (median survival not yet reached in low IgM-DR group; 395 days in high IgM-DR group; Pā€‰<ā€‰.0001 by the log-rank test).
